RER Solutions, Inc., is accepting resumes for a Communications Associate to become a part of our superior workforce in the Washington, DC, area. The Communications Associate will provide onsite and remote federal program leadership.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Support the media relations team in creating and executing communications strategies and building national, local, and trade press lists
  • Monitor and track media
  • Compile daily press clips and distribute them to the office
  • Assist in the development of materials intended for the media, such as press releases, talking points, newsletters, pitches, and weekly reports
  • Schedule media engagements for principals
  • Consistently and reliably foster a spirit of collaboration by showing initiative, willingness to help others, and commitment to team goals

Requirements

  • Minimum of US Citizenship required to obtain client-issued Public Trust
  • Four years of experience developing/drafting strategic media and communications plans
  • One year or one campaign cycle of communications experience or experience at a communications/public relations firm, government or political environment, or journalism
  • Experience interfacing with media, journalists, and media literacy
  • Experience developing/drafting strategic media and communications plans
  • Experience coordinating across organizations/ working collaboratively on complex projects
  • General knowledge of and passion for clean energy and climate change policy
  • Interest in research, messaging, and promoting/explaining policy
  • Excellent written and oral communication skills
  • Excellent attention to detail and an understanding of fundamental business writing
  • Possess exemplary organizational skills and the ability to prioritize tasks.
  • Sensitivity to confidential material
  • Expertise in Microsoft Office Products (i.e.,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Outlook)

EDUCATION: Bachelor's Degree
